Can you create a deliverability presentation solely in memes and movie quotes?

Summary

Experts, marketers, and documentation alike agree that incorporating memes, movie quotes, and relatable cultural references into presentations, especially those concerning complex topics like email deliverability, significantly enhances audience engagement, comprehension, and retention. These elements add humor and personality, making the content more accessible and memorable by bridging the gap between technical expertise and general understanding.
